YeboLearn Integrations: The Connected School Ecosystem
Executive Summary
YeboLearn isn't just a platform—it's the central nervous system connecting all school operations. With production-ready integrations to payment providers, AI services, and communication platforms, plus 100+ API endpoints for custom integrations, we deliver the connectivity that modern schools demand while competitors remain isolated islands.
Current Production Integrations
Payment Integrations
MTN Mobile Money
Status: ✅ Live in Production Coverage: Ghana, Uganda, Rwanda, Cameroon Capabilities:
- Direct fee payments via USSD
- Automated payment reconciliation
- Bulk disbursements for refunds
- Real-time payment notifications
- Parent wallet top-ups
- Split payments support
Technical Details:
- API Version: MTN MoMo API v2.0
- Authentication: OAuth 2.0
- Webhook support for instant notifications
- Average processing time: ❤️ seconds
- Success rate: 99.2%
Business Impact:
- 65% of parents prefer mobile money
- 40% faster fee collection
- 90% reduction in cash handling
Stripe
Status: ✅ Live in Production Coverage: International payments, credit cards Capabilities:
- Credit/debit card processing
- Recurring subscription billing
- International payment support
- PCI DSS compliant
- Automated invoice generation
- Multi-currency support (15+ currencies)
Technical Details:
- Stripe API v2023-10
- Strong Customer Authentication (SCA)
- 3D Secure 2.0 support
- Tokenized card storage
- Average processing time: <2 seconds
Why This Matters: While competitors struggle with manual payment recording, YeboLearn processes thousands of payments daily with automatic reconciliation.
AI Integration
Google Gemini AI
Status: ✅ Live in Production Model: Gemini Pro 1.5 Capabilities:
Current AI Features Powered:
- Intelligent grading assistance
- Automated report card comments
- Lesson plan generation
- Student performance predictions
- Natural language queries
- Content summarization
- Multi-language translation
- Personalized learning recommendations
- Automated question generation
- Plagiarism detection
- Study material creation
- Career guidance
- Parent communication drafts
- Administrative insights
- Predictive analytics
Technical Integration:
- API Version: Google AI Studio v1
- Response time: <1 second average
- Token optimization for cost efficiency
- Fallback mechanisms for high availability
- Fine-tuning for educational context
Competitive Moat: We're the ONLY African school platform with production AI integration. Competitors are years away from this capability.
Communication Integrations (Coming Q1-Q2 2025)
WhatsApp Business API
Status: 🚧 Development (Launch: February 2025) Planned Capabilities:
- Automated attendance notifications
- Fee payment reminders
- Two-way parent-teacher communication
- Broadcast announcements
- Document sharing (report cards, receipts)
- Chatbot for common queries
- Quick reply templates
- Rich media support
Why WhatsApp:
- 90% of African parents use WhatsApp daily
- 98% message open rate
- Familiar interface requires no training
- Works on feature phones
SMS Gateway (Production)
Status: ✅ Live in Production Providers: Twilio, Africa's Talking Capabilities:
- Bulk SMS broadcasting
- Personalized messages
- Delivery reports
- Two-way SMS
- Scheduled messages
- Unicode support for local languages
Future Integration Roadmap
Q1 2025 Integrations
M-Pesa
Target Launch: March 2025 Markets: Kenya, Tanzania, Mozambique Expected Impact:
- Access to 50M+ users
- 70% of Kenyan parents prefer M-Pesa
- Instant payment processing
- Lipa Na M-Pesa for merchants
Microsoft Teams for Education
Target Launch: March 2025 Capabilities:
- Virtual classroom integration
- Assignment sync
- Calendar integration
- Grade sync
- Document collaboration
Q2 2025 Integrations
Zoom Education
Target Launch: April 2025 Capabilities:
- One-click class sessions
- Attendance tracking
- Recording management
- Breakout rooms for groups
- Whiteboard integration
Google Workspace for Education
Target Launch: May 2025 Capabilities:
- Google Classroom sync
- Drive integration for assignments
- Calendar synchronization
- Gmail for school domains
- Collaborative documents
Learning Management Systems
Target Launch: June 2025 Platforms:
- Moodle
- Canvas
- Blackboard
- Google Classroom
Q3-Q4 2025 Integrations
Regional Payment Providers
- Paystack (Nigeria, Ghana)
- Flutterwave (Pan-African)
- DPO PayGate (South Africa)
- Vodacom M-Pesa (Tanzania, DRC)
- Airtel Money (14 African countries)
- Orange Money (West Africa)
Government Systems
- National ID Verification (Ghana, Kenya, SA)
- Exam Board Integration (WAEC, KNEC)
- Ministry Reporting (Automated compliance)
- Teacher Certification (Verification systems)
Educational Content
- Khan Academy (Free courses)
- Coursera for Schools (Skills development)
- YouTube Education (Video content)
- African Storybook (Local content)
- Ubongo (Edutainment content)
API Capabilities
RESTful API Architecture
Endpoints: 100+ production-ready Documentation: Swagger/OpenAPI 3.0 Authentication: JWT with refresh tokens Rate Limiting: 1000 requests/minute per school
Core API Categories
Student Management APIs (15 endpoints)
GET /api/v1/students
POST /api/v1/students
GET /api/v1/students/{id}
PUT /api/v1/students/{id}
DELETE /api/v1/students/{id}
POST /api/v1/students/bulk-import
GET /api/v1/students/searchAcademic APIs (20 endpoints)
GET /api/v1/grades
POST /api/v1/grades/bulk
GET /api/v1/attendance
POST /api/v1/attendance/mark
GET /api/v1/assignments
POST /api/v1/exams/scheduleFinancial APIs (12 endpoints)
POST /api/v1/payments
GET /api/v1/payments/status
POST /api/v1/fees/structure
GET /api/v1/invoices
POST /api/v1/receipts/generateIntegration APIs (10 endpoints)
POST /api/v1/webhooks/register
GET /api/v1/webhooks/events
POST /api/v1/integrations/connect
GET /api/v1/integrations/statusWebhook Events
Real-time notifications for:
- Student enrollment
- Payment received
- Attendance marked
- Grade updated
- Assignment submitted
- Fee reminder triggered
- Report card generated
API Developer Experience
- Interactive API explorer
- Sandbox environment
- SDKs (JavaScript, Python, PHP)
- Postman collections
- Code examples
- Rate limit headers
- Comprehensive error codes
Integration Security
Data Protection
- End-to-end encryption for sensitive data
- OAuth 2.0 for third-party auth
- API key rotation every 90 days
- IP whitelisting available
- Audit logs for all API calls
Compliance
- PCI DSS for payment processing
- GDPR/POPIA for data protection
- SOC 2 Type II certification (in progress)
- ISO 27001 compliance (planned)
Custom Integration Support
Professional Services
- Custom API development
- Legacy system migration
- Data transformation services
- Integration consulting
- Training and documentation
Integration Marketplace (Coming 2026)
- Third-party app store
- Revenue sharing model
- Certified partner program
- Community integrations
- Open-source connectors
Integration Success Stories
Case Study: Springfield International School
Challenge: 5 disconnected systems for different functions Solution: YeboLearn with MTN Mobile Money and Google Workspace Result:
- 60% cost reduction
- 80% faster fee collection
- 100% parent satisfaction
Case Study: National School Chain (15 schools)
Challenge: No standardized payment across branches Solution: Multi-tenant YeboLearn with Stripe and M-Pesa Result:
- Centralized financial reporting
- 45% improvement in collection rate
- Real-time visibility across all schools
Competitive Integration Analysis
| Platform | Payment Integrations | AI Integration | APIs | Webhooks | Documentation |
|---|---|---|---|---|---|
| YeboLearn | 2 live, 8 coming | ✅ Google Gemini | 100+ | ✅ Real-time | ✅ Swagger |
| Competitor A | 1 (bank only) | ❌ None | 10 | ❌ None | PDF only |
| Competitor B | 0 (manual) | ❌ None | 0 | ❌ None | ❌ None |
| Competitor C | 1 (basic) | ❌ None | 20 | Email only | Basic |
The Integration Advantage
Why Schools Choose YeboLearn
Without YeboLearn:
- Manual payment recording (2 days delay)
- Disconnected systems requiring duplicate entry
- No API access for custom needs
- WhatsApp groups for communication (chaos)
- No AI capabilities
With YeboLearn:
- Instant payment processing and reconciliation
- Everything connected in one platform
- 100+ APIs for any integration need
- Structured multi-channel communication
- 15 AI features enhancing every aspect
ROI of Integrations
Measurable Impact
- Payment Integration: 40% faster collection, 90% less manual work
- AI Integration: 10 hours/week saved per teacher
- SMS Integration: 3x parent engagement
- API Usage: 50% reduction in IT costs
- Overall Efficiency: 60% operational improvement
Integration Roadmap Priorities
2025 Focus Areas
- Payment Coverage: 95% of African payment methods
- Communication: WhatsApp, Teams, Zoom integration
- AI Expansion: Custom model training
- Government: Compliance automation
- Learning: LMS and content partnerships
2026 Vision
- 50+ production integrations
- App marketplace launch
- AI API for third parties
- Blockchain credentials
- IoT device integration (biometrics, cameras)
Developer Partnership Program
For System Integrators
- Certified partner status
- Technical training
- Sales enablement
- Revenue sharing
- Marketing support
For Schools' IT Teams
- API workshop training
- Direct support channel
- Custom integration assistance
- Priority feature requests
- Beta program access
The Bottom Line
YeboLearn's integration ecosystem transforms schools from isolated operations into connected, intelligent enterprises. With payment processing that works, AI that delivers value, and APIs that enable anything, we're not just integrated—we're the integration platform for African education.
Current Reality: 2 payment, 1 AI, 100+ APIs 2025 Target: 15+ integrations, 150+ APIs 2026 Vision: Complete ecosystem leadership
Ready to connect your school to the future? YeboLearn makes it possible today.